- Features of product
More than 12000 ports and 72 millions distances database
A number of routing points choice (Panama, Suez, Kiel canal and others)
Providing coordinates to port distance (Invalid in demo version)
Providing coordinates to coordinates distance (Invalid in demo version)
Providing waypoints in route
View Map with Netpas Distance map
Supporting SECA (Sulphur Oxide Emission Control Areas)
Supporting Somalian Piracy Area compatible with the latest JWLA
Compatible with Webservice Standard 1.0
RPC / Encoded SOAP Message
Can be integrated into your In-House System
Speedy update of missing port : within 2 weeks

1. Abstract
Netpas Webservice is a service based on Webservice which is transferring way of SOAP message.
If a client transfers a SOAP Request message to our Distance server, the Distance server returns SOAP Response to the client.
Webservice Client Stub makes a communication possible between server and clients. User can create Webservice Client Stub in MS .NET, Apache Axis and Delphi and Other development language easily.

2. How to work
WSDL(Webservice Definition Language) Document contains how to use Webservice. In this document, you can find out how to send Request and Response and how to create Client Stub.
